HOTEL ARCO PALACE - Contacts


Primary Contacts

24 Hours Help Desk 5 Floors Building

Other Phones

+91 0141 4015987
+91 0141 4027216
+91 0141 4035987
+91 92616 92616
+91 92617 92617
+918829988299

Other Emails